Output 31fd8243c2076217bba79190ef94f11a20a89c1e46f08bc5224dc8c3fb303188:1

value
1722610
script pubkey
OP_0 OP_PUSHBYTES_20 25490c4779305023370b65af0c93f8642b55fe22
address
ltc1qy4ysc3mexpgzxdctvkhseylcvs44tl3zuulkgw
transaction
31fd8243c2076217bba79190ef94f11a20a89c1e46f08bc5224dc8c3fb303188
spent
true